This book presents a historical account of the H.M.S. Rattlesnake's significant voyage through Australian and New Guinean waters. The narrative covers the period from 1845 to 1850, detailing the ship's exploration and activities during this mid-19th century expedition. Readers gain insight into the challenges and discoveries encountered by the crew as they navigated these regions. The text offers a comprehensive look at this particular naval journey.
